WebFeb 20, 2024 · What is a syllable? A syllable is an unbroken vowel sound within a word. Notice that we say a vowel sound, not just a vowel by itself. A vowel sound contains whichever consonants (and other vowels) are attached to a vowel to make a certain, distinct sound.. For example, the word blanket has two syllables: blan + ket.The syllables are …

Cite This Source. fond microsoft learning i cairns queenslandWebThere is a large class of such words characterized by ambiguity in stress placements. When a word can be stressed on two different syllables, stress placement determines the part of speech of the word (e.g. whether it is a verb or a noun). As a rule of thumb, if the stress is on the second syllable, the word is usually a verb. fond microsoftWebWe use superlative adjectives when we compare one thing (object / person) with many things, this object stands out because it has more of a quality than others in the same group..
